#root{isolation:isolate}:root{--bg:#0b0d11;--panel:#11151a;--edge:#1b2230;--text:#e9ecf1;--muted:#ffffff;--blue:#3b82f6;--violet:#7e6fff;--header: #6d7aff;--urlColour: #7aacfdff;--accent: linear-gradient(90deg, var(--violet), var(--blue));--radius:14px;--shadow:0 10px 30px rgba(0,0,0,.45)}*{box-sizing:border-box}html,body{min-height:100%;min-height:100vh}html{scroll-behavior:smooth}body{margin:0;font-family:Inter,system-ui,Segoe UI,Roboto,Arial,sans-serif;color:var(--text);background:radial-gradient(1200px 800px at 70% -10%,#122241 0%,transparent 60%),var(--bg)}html,body{scrollbar-width:none;-ms-overflow-style:none}html::-webkit-scrollbar,body::-webkit-scrollbar{display:none}a{color:inherit;text-decoration:none}button{font:inherit}.container{width:min(1140px,92vw)}.glass{background:linear-gradient(180deg,#ffffff0f,#ffffff08);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border:1px solid rgba(255,255,255,.06);border-radius:var(--radius)}.card{background:linear-gradient(180deg,#ffffff0a,#ffffff05);border:1px solid rgba(255,255,255,.07);border-radius:var(--radius);box-shadow:var(--shadow)}.chip{display:inline-flex;align-items:center;gap:.5rem;padding:.4rem .7rem;border-radius:999px;border:1px solid var(--edge);background:#ffffff0a;font-size:.9rem;color:var(--text);white-space:nowrap}.section{scroll-margin-top:110px}.fs-0,.fs-1,.fs-2,.fs-3,.fs-4,.fs-5,strong{color:var(--text);font-weight:700}.h1{font-size:clamp(2rem,7vw,3.5rem);line-height:1.1;letter-spacing:-.01em;font-weight:800;color:var(--text)}.text-color{color:var(--text)}.h2{font-size:clamp(1.4rem,4vw,2rem);line-height:1.2;font-weight:700;margin:0 0 .75rem;color:var(--text)}.p{color:var(--muted);font-size:1.05rem;line-height:1.65}.btn{display:inline-flex;align-items:center;gap:.6rem;padding:.7rem 1rem;opacity:.9;padding:.3rem .8rem;border-radius:10px;color:#fff;transition:.3s}.btn:hover{background:#ffffff1f;color:#fff}.btn:first-child:active,.btn:active,.btn-group .btn:active{color:#fff}.btn.primary{background:var(--accent);color:#fff;border:none}.btn.primary:hover{transform:translateY(-3px)}.nav{position:sticky;top:0;z-index:50;padding:.6rem 0;margin:0}.nav-inner{display:flex;align-items:center;justify-content:space-between;padding:.5rem .8rem}.nav-links{display:flex;gap:.2rem;flex-wrap:wrap}.nav a{opacity:.9;padding:.3rem .8rem;border-radius:10px}.nav a:hover{background:#ffffff0f}.nav a:hover.btn.primary{transform:translateY(-2px);background:var(--accent);color:#fff;border:white}.kbd{font-family:JetBrains Mono,ui-monospace,SFMono-Regular,Menlo,Consolas,monospace;font-size:.85rem}hr.sep{border:0;height:3px;background:linear-gradient(90deg,transparent,white,transparent);margin-bottom:16px 0}.progress{position:fixed;top:0;left:0;height:12px;width:100%;z-index:60;pointer-events:none;background:linear-gradient(90deg,var(--violet),var(--blue));transform-origin:0 0;transform:scaleX(0)}.masonry-grid{display:-webkit-box;display:-ms-flexbox;display:flex;width:auto;gap:1rem}.masonry-grid_column{background-clip:padding-box}.masonry-grid_column>div{margin-bottom:20px}a.url{color:var(--urlColour)}.video-container{position:relative;overflow:hidden;width:100%;padding-top:56.25%}.video-container iframe{position:absolute;top:0;left:0;width:100%;height:100%;border:0}.selected{background-color:#3df881;color:#1a1a1a;font-weight:501}
